Interactive Python and Jupyter workflows for preparing OpenGeoMetadata Aardvark metadata for AGSL GeoDiscovery.

Requirements:
- mise
- Python 3.12
- Jupyter Notebook (https://jupyter.org/install)
- Pandas (https://pandas.pydata.org/getting_started.html)
- Numpy* (https://numpy.org/install/)
*only needed for clean-validate
This repo uses mise to pin the Python version and a local .venv for dependencies.
mise install
python -m venv .venv
source .venv/bin/activate
pip install -r requirements.txt
